JS: Accept regression in overload resolution

Overload resolution has little impact on data flow analysis, because there we care about the concrete implementation of the function, which is the same for all overloads. It can affect the return type, which in turn can affect the call graph we generate, but we'll just have to accept this as overload resolution is too hard without negative recursion.
